Lingey House Primary School Catchment Area Information
What is the catchment area for Lingey House Primary School?
The catchment area for Lingey House Primary School is the geographic zone Gateshead uses to prioritise admissions when this primary school receives more applications than it has places. Children living inside the boundary are ranked higher under the oversubscription criteria, after looked-after children and siblings. Gateshead publishes the exact boundary and the last distance offered before each admissions cycle, and the boundary can change year to year.

Lingey House Primary School has a published admission number of 524 places. 453 pupils were enrolled in the most recent data, giving a fill rate of 86%. At 86% full, the school currently has headroom below its 524 place limit. Catchment distance criteria still apply when the school is oversubscribed, but at current demand levels, places have been available for applicants outside the immediate catchment area.
The fill-rate figure above reflects overall demand, but the school's intake also varies by community profile. 29.8% of pupils at Lingey House Primary School are eligible for free school meals, broadly in line with the national average. This reflects a mixed catchment population across Gateshead.
